Conservatives have decried higher education as a center of liberal indoctrination for decades, and under the second Trump administration, colleges and universities are watching their federal funding be withheld or frozen, their presidents step down, and professors lose their jobs.What can be done to wrest back academic freedom and independence from a vindictive administration?Guest:  Sarah Brown, senior editor of the Chronicle of Higher Education.Want more What Next?
